installed tanabe 2" DF springs
pretty easy install, took me hour and half to do all 4, the tanabe springs came with new bump stops too. the rides a bit softer...i still have to wait for the springs to settle but as for now with the 17x7 work wheels with 205-40 tires, the front has a tite 3 finger gap and the rear has 2 finger gap from tires to fender measure, overall im happy with the springs, they are the pink colored tanabe springs...for pictures you can go to my site.

as for the ride being bouncy...its not to bad...its not a constat bounce like cut springs, but yea theres a tad of bounce but its soft and not harsh...can tolerate. for sure it absorbs the road better than stock springs, those were so stiff. $200 for some goldlines installed is a hell of a deal, go for it!
